Fundraiser to benefit Paso Robles Center for the Performing Arts 

Four Lanterns Winery hosting, ‘an evening to remember’

–Four Lanterns Winery will host an evening of classical music on Sept. 23 at their tasting room with proceeds to benefit The Paso Robles Center for the Performing Arts.

Violinists Helen Nightengale and Jacqueline Brand will perform an eclectic program in the intimate setting of the Four Lanterns tasting room.

Nightengale made her solo debut at age 10. She has performed with orchestras throughout the world and is active on the studio recording scene, having performed on over five hundred film scores including “Star Wars: The Force Awakens”, “Schindlers List”, “Star Trek,” and Indiana Jones” among many others.

Brand began playing the violin at the age of 3 ½, and at 12 began to study with the great Jascha Heifetz. A member of the Los Angeles Chamber Orchestra since 1985, she has soloed in festivals and with orchestras around the world.

Wine will be available for purchase with complimentary light appetizers.

Doors open at 5:45. Only 50 tickets will be available at $30.
